Abstract

A design problem of delayed feedback controllers in the sampled-data system configuration is considered. Instead of indirect methods via the plant augmentation, we impose certain interpolation conditions on the free parameter of the stabilizing controller parametrization to embed the desired structure into the controller directly. Since the underlying stabilization problem to be solved is independent of the length of the delay, the proposed method avoids a computational burden when the ratio of the periods of the target orbit to the sampling becomes larger.
